Front Seat, Removing With Faulty Seat Forward/Back Adjustment Motor
Special tools and workshop equipment required
- Universal Vehicle Protector : VAS871001
- Follow the safety precautions. Refer to SAFETY PRECAUTIONS WHEN WORKING WITH PYROTECHNIC COMPONENTS .
- To complete the procedure, a second technician is required to be at the following position. Refer to FRONT SEAT, REMOVING WITH FAULTY SEAT FORWARD/BACK ADJUSTMENT MOTOR - Remove the front seat from the vehicle with a second technician. .
Driver Seat Forward/Back Adjustment Motor -V28- /Front Passenger Seat Forward/Back Adjustment Motor -V31-, Checking
-- Move the front seat into its highest position.
- To avoid unnecessary repair costs, check electrical and electronic components and wires before removing the front seat any more.
-- Perform the following tests:
- Check the fuse. Refer to the appropriate Wiring Diagram.
- Check the voltage at the connector station and perform Fault Finding if necessary. Refer to the appropriate Wiring Diagram.
- Check the voltage on the seat forward/back adjustment motor. Refer to the appropriate Wiring Diagram.
- Check the voltage on the seat adjustment control head, and perform Fault Finding if necessary. Refer to the appropriate Wiring Diagram.
-- Replace the fuse if faulty. Refer to the appropriate Wiring Diagram.
-- If there is no voltage, repair or replace the wire. Refer to the appropriate Wiring Diagram.
-- If the control head is faulty: replace the Driver Seat Adjustment Control Head -E470- / Front Passenger Seat Adjustment Control Head -E471-. Refer to Driver Seat Adjustment Control Head -E470- /Front Passenger Seat Adjustment Control Head -E471-, REMOVING AND INSTALLING .
-- If the seat forward/back adjustment motor is faulty, replace the seat pan lower frame. Refer to OVERVIEW - SEAT PAN .
Removing with faulty Driver Seat Forward/Back Adjustment Motor -V28- /Front Passenger Seat Forward/Back Adjustment Motor -V31-
-- If necessary, remove the storage compartment. Refer to STORAGE COMPARTMENT, REMOVING AND INSTALLING .
-- If necessary, remove the fire extinguisher mount. Refer to FIRE EXTINGUISHER MOUNT, REMOVING AND INSTALLING .
-- If necessary, remove the Owner's Manual bracket. Refer to OWNER'S MANUAL BRACKET, REMOVING AND INSTALLING .
-- Disconnect the connector from the seat forward/back adjustment motor.
-- Free up the electrical wire.
-- Remove the seat rail cover on the side sill side. Refer to SEAT RAIL COVER, REMOVING AND INSTALLING, SIDE SILL SIDE .
-- Remove the bolts -1 and 2- and remove the faulty seat forward/back adjustment motor -3- with the bracket.
-- Remove the accessible bolts for the seat rails.
-- Push the front seat forward and back to remove the accessible bolts for the seat rails.
-- Tilt the front seat rearward.
-- Q3: remove the expanding rivets -1 and 2- and remove the cover -3- in direction of -arrow-.
-- Remove the expanding rivet -2- and fold up the section of the carpet -1-.
-- Unclip the cable holder -3-.
Risk of airbag deployment.
Risk of injury.
- Check if the airbag indicator lamp turns on or blinks.
- If the airbag indicator lamp turns on or blinks, the DTC memory must be read.
- If >>short circuit to positive<< is a DTC memory entry, disconnect the battery. Refer to BATTERY, DISCONNECTING AND CONNECTING .
- If there is a DTC memory entry, the Guided Fault Finding instructions on the Vehicle Diagnostic Tester must always be followed.
- If the airbag indicator lamp does not turn on or blink, or there is no DTC memory entry with >>short circuit to positive<< : switch off the ignition, keep the ignition key outside of the vehicle and wait 10 seconds.
Pyrotechnical components can deploy unintentionally.
Risk of injury.
- Discharge the static electricity: quickly touch the door striker.
-- Disconnect the connectors on the connector station in the floor.

-- To protect the sill panel before prying out the front seat, attach the Universal Vehicle Protector: VAS871001 .
-- Remove the front seat from the vehicle with a second technician.
-- Replace the seat pan lower frame. Refer to OVERVIEW - SEAT PAN .
-- Install the front seat. Refer to Installing .
